OnePlus 13 vs Xiaomi 15 Pro: Which One Should You Choose?

A direct comparison of OnePlus 13 and Xiaomi 15 Pro in performance and design.

Choosing between the OnePlus 13 and Xiaomi 15 Pro can be challenging for anyone considering a premium Android smartphone in 2025. Both devices offer top-tier performance, advanced camera systems, and sleek designs. In this detailed comparison, we’ll evaluate their specifications, build quality, performance, and pricing to help you understand how they differ.

Key Specifications

Both smartphones come with impressive hardware. The OnePlus 13 continues the brand’s tradition of delivering performance-driven phones, while the Xiaomi 15 Pro pushes camera and charging tech even further.

Below is a quick comparison of their main specifications:

Verdict: Which Mobile Should You Buy?

If you prefer a streamlined user interface, reliable long-term software support, and a slightly larger battery, the OnePlus 13 is an excellent choice. On the other hand, if you value advanced camera performance, faster wired charging, and expanded storage, the Xiaomi 15 Pro is a compelling option.
